Seven people have been killed and 82 are missing after a landslide in the West Bandung region of Indonesia’s West Java province, Indonesia disaster mitigation agency spokesperson Abdul Muhari said.
The landslide on Saturday comes after deadly landslides and flooding left more than 1,170 people dead across Indonesia’s North Sumatra, West Sumatra, and Aceh provinces last month.
